Nearly every Hindu, Jain, or Sikh household has a dedicated corner or room for a deity. This isn't just decoration. The day begins here. The mother or grandmother lights the diya (lamp) before the coffee is brewed. In many households, no one eats breakfast until the morning aarti (prayer) is complete.

The day begins early, often before the sun rises. In many homes, the first sound is the sweeping of the front porch, followed by the drawing of a rangoli (geometric chalk patterns) to welcome prosperity.
